Comprehensive A Level Chemistry Curriculum
The course covers all major A Level Chemistry topics, including:
Physical Chemistry
- Atomic Structure
- Mole Concept
- Chemical Bonding
- Energetics
- Equilibrium
- Reaction Kinetics
- Electrochemistry
Organic Chemistry
- Hydrocarbons
- Alkanes and Alkenes
- Alcohols
- Carbonyl Compounds
- Carboxylic Acids
- Amines
- Organic Synthesis
Inorganic Chemistry
- Periodicity
- Group Chemistry
- Transition Elements
- Coordination Chemistry
- Nitrogen and Sulfur Chemistry
Practical and Analytical Chemistry
- Experimental Techniques
- Qualitative Analysis
- Quantitative Analysis
- Data Interpretation
- Laboratory Skills

Recommended Age Group
A Level Chemistry is generally suitable for students aged 16 to 19 years, typically studying:
- AS Level (Year 12)
- A Level (Year 13)
The course is particularly beneficial for students planning careers in medicine, healthcare, engineering, biotechnology, environmental sciences, and scientific research.
